应用性能管理:打造高效、稳定的企业IT系统
在当今快速发展的信息化时代,企业IT系统的性能管理已经成为企业竞争力的重要组成部分。应用性能管理(APM)作为IT运维的重要手段,对于打造高效、稳定的企业IT系统具有重要意义。本文将从APM的定义、重要性、实施方法以及未来发展趋势等方面进行详细阐述。
一、APM的定义
应用性能管理(APM)是指通过实时监控、分析、优化企业IT系统中应用性能的一种技术。它涵盖了应用性能的各个方面,包括应用响应时间、资源消耗、错误率、用户体验等。APM的核心目标是提高企业IT系统的稳定性和效率,确保业务连续性和用户满意度。
二、APM的重要性
- 提高企业竞争力
在激烈的市场竞争中,企业需要不断优化IT系统,提高业务效率。APM可以帮助企业实时监控应用性能,发现潜在问题,提前进行优化,从而提升企业竞争力。
- 保障业务连续性
企业IT系统是支撑业务运营的基础,应用性能的稳定直接影响着业务的连续性。通过APM,企业可以及时发现系统故障,迅速定位问题,降低故障对业务的影响。
- 降低运维成本
APM可以帮助企业实时监控应用性能,及时发现和解决问题,减少故障发生频率,降低运维成本。
- 提升用户体验
良好的应用性能可以提升用户体验,增强用户对企业的信任度。通过APM,企业可以持续优化应用性能,提升用户满意度。
三、APM实施方法
- 选择合适的APM工具
市场上存在众多APM工具,企业应根据自身需求选择合适的工具。在选择过程中,要考虑以下因素:功能完整性、易用性、扩展性、支持性等。
- 明确监控指标
明确监控指标是APM实施的基础。企业应根据业务需求,制定合理的监控指标体系,包括应用响应时间、资源消耗、错误率、用户体验等。
- 建立监控体系
根据监控指标,建立完善的监控体系,包括数据采集、存储、分析、报警等环节。确保监控数据准确、及时、全面。
- 定期分析、优化
定期对监控数据进行分析,找出影响应用性能的关键因素,制定优化方案。同时,关注新技术、新方法,持续优化APM体系。
- 培训和团队建设
加强APM团队建设,提高团队成员的专业技能。定期组织培训和交流,提升团队整体水平。
四、APM未来发展趋势
- 智能化
随着人工智能、大数据等技术的发展,APM将更加智能化。通过智能算法,APM能够自动发现、定位和解决问题,降低人工干预。
- 云化
随着云计算的普及,APM将逐渐向云化方向发展。企业可以通过云APM平台,实现跨地域、跨应用的性能监控和管理。
- 集成化
APM将与其他IT运维工具、业务系统等实现集成,形成统一的运维管理平台。企业可以借助集成化APM,实现全面、高效的性能管理。
- 安全性
随着网络安全事件的增多,APM将更加注重安全性。企业需要确保APM系统本身的安全性,同时关注应用性能与安全之间的平衡。
总之,应用性能管理在打造高效、稳定的企业IT系统中发挥着重要作用。企业应充分认识到APM的重要性,积极探索和实践,不断提升IT系统的性能和稳定性,为企业发展提供有力支撑。
猜你喜欢:全栈链路追踪